Primary Use
Silicon source for semiconductor deposition

Silane is a colorless, flammable, and poisonous gas with a strong repulsive odor. It is easily ignited in air and is very toxic by inhalation.

Source of hyperpure silicon for semiconductorsDoping agent for solid-state devicesProduction of amorphous silicon
